INGREDIENTS NEEDED TO MAKE CHOCOLATE BUNS

For chocolate buns dough

  1. Flour :325 g (2 1/2 cups)
  2. Slightly warm water or milk (not hot) :195-210 ml (3/4 cup +1 -2 tbsp)
  3. Butter :42.6 g (3 tbsp)
  4. Yeast :1 and 1/2 tsp
  5. Sugar :2 1/2 tbsp (30g)
  6. Salt:1 tsp (6g)
  7. Chocolate spread as required

For the chocolate swirls

  1. Flour :2 tbsp(15-16 g)
  2. cocoa powder :1 tsp(2.5 g)
  3. Sugar :1 tsp(4.5 g)
  4. Water :1-2 tbsp (20-30 ml)to make a thick paste

1.PREPARE THE CHOCOLATE BREAD ROLL DOUGH

Into a bowl,lets add all our ingredients together and mix them to form a shaggy mass of dough.

Add the milk, sugar, yeast, salt ,butter and flour and mix them together.

Transfer the dough onto a clean work surface and knead the dough until the dough become soft and elastic.

Only a well kneaded dough can produce soft and fluffy dinner rolls .

The dough will be wet and so we may find it difficult to knead just as we knead a bread dough in the beginning.

Slapping the dough on the work surface and then folding the dough and repeating he same motion will help you develop the gluten strands.

The extra moisture will be absorbed by the dough in about 10 minutes and the dough will be smooth and elastic at about 15 minutes of kneading.

How should I know my dough is kneaded well?

We can test the doneness of dinner roll dough :If properly kneaded, the dough should stretch, without tearing or breaking, into a thin membrane that you can see through.

If we are using bread flour it is easy to attain this stage of dough(it may take around 10 minutes of kneading);As bread dough contains more proteins than all purpose flour.

But if we are using all purpose flour,it may take longer to attain this stage of perfection.

Our bread would still be good and soft even if our dough didn’t pass this window pane test.But if the dough passes the window pane test ,and the one hour proofing,then it is guaranteed that your bread will be super soft and fluffy.

It will be so much easier if you are using a stand mixer to prepare the dough.In a stand mixer,just knead the dough for 8-10 minutes using the dough hook attachment.

2.DIVIDE AND SHAPE THE DOUGH

Now, divide the dough into 15 equal pieces.For more precision,I weighed each of them and they were 38-40 g in weight.

Roll each piece of dough into small balls.Tuck in the edges towards the centre and roll the balls into small round balls.

Then take each dough ball and then press and shape it into thin circular sheet .

It is better to keep the center part thicker.Otherwise the dough layer on top will be thin and the chocolate will ooze out while baking.

Place some chocolate spread or nutella in the center of the circle.

Tuck in the edges and pinch together to form round balls

Place the rolls on a nonstick baking tray or on to parchment lined baking tray or on to a well greased baking tray.

Do I need to chill the chocolate spread before using it as chocolate bun filling

I have tried using the chilled chocolate spread and chocolate spread kept at room temperature.

I didn’t find any difference when it is baked.

The one convenience while using chilled chocolate spread is that it will make the process easy and clean while shaping the bread rolls.

When I used chilled chocolate spread, it took longer time to proof the chocolate buns.The action of yeast will be slow and retarded when it is in a cold environment.

So If your place is cold and not very hot, we don’t need to keep the chocolate spread in refrigerator.But if your place is hot, you may find it difficult to roll and shape the bread dough .In that case, you can keep the chocolate spread in fridge and then use it for filling.

Can I use baking chocolate instead of chocolate spread for the chocolate bun filling

Yes you can use.I have tried chocolate chips as well.

3.PROOF THE NUTELLA ROLLS DOUGH

Let the dough ball sit in a warm environment for about 80 minutes or until they puff up and get doubled in size.

After proofing at around 80-90 minutes ,brush the top of those rolls with an egg wash to make our rolls shiny and golden brown in colour when they are baked.

And Optionally make some chocolate swirls on top of the proofed dough.

HOW TO MAKE THE CHOCOLATE PASTE FOR SWIRLS

Into a bowl add some flour ,sugar, cocoa powder.

Add enough water to make a thick but runny batter.

Transfer the chocolate batter onto a piping bag.

Make swirls on top of the buns.

This give beautiful chocolate swirl pattern on top the buns.

Now they are ready to to go into the oven.

4. BAKE THE CHOCOLATE BREAD ROLLS

Bake the rolls in a 375 F preheated oven for 18-20 minutes.

How to prevent the top of chocolate dinner rolls from over browning ?

  1. Place an aluminum foil on top to prevent over browning,whenever you feel so
  2. You can place the baking tray way from the heating coils to prevent this issue..(I placed my baking tray in the lowest rack of the oven as the heating coils were on the upside)

If the nutella filled dinner rolls are under baked, the inside will be doughy and they smell yeasty.So bake sufficiently for 17-20 minutes.

CAN I ADD EGG IN THIS NUTELLA ROLLS RECIPE?

Yes you can add egg in this hazelnut rolls if you want to.

As one egg is approximately 45 ml,just reduce 45 ml ( 3 tablespoon) of milk while you add an egg.

chocolate bread rolls

HOW TO STORE NUTELLA BUNS?

Once the rolls are completely cooled,place the stuffed rolls in a plastic storage bag, or wrap in foil and store at room temperature.

Properly stored,these sweet dinner rolls will last for about 3-4 days at normal room temperature.

In extremely warm, humid temperatures,the chocolate buns should be frozen for longer-term storage.

For freezing: Place the buns in a heavy-duty freezer bag or wrap the buns tightly with aluminum foil or plastic freezer wrap and freeze.

Properly stored, they will maintain best quality for about 3 months.
